key responsibilities
Assist with day-to-day HR operations and administrative tasks.Maintain employee records and ensure data accuracy and confidentiality.
Support the recruitment process, including posting job openings, scheduling interviews, and conducting reference checks.Assist in onboarding new employees and coordinating training sessions.
Handle employee inquiries and provide excellent customer service.Prepare HR-related documents, reports, and presentations.
Assist in organizing company events and employee engagement activities.Support the implementation of HR policies and procedures.
Perform other duties as assigned by the HR Manager.
